About Comanche County Memorial Hospital
Comanche County Memorial Hospital in southwest Oklahoma offers compassionate behavioral health care for children and adults facing challenges such as depression, anxiety, PTSD, schizophrenia, bipolar disorder, and ADHD. With both inpatient and outpatient services, patients receive tailored care in a safe, supportive environment, including 24/7 supervision during inpatient stays.
The hospital’s team-based approach combines individual and group therapy, cognitive behavioral therapy (CBT), medication-assisted therapy (MAT), social skills training, and engaging activities. These therapies empower patients to manage symptoms, build coping skills, and improve their overall well-being. Skilled therapists and medical staff collaborate closely to create personalized treatment plans that promote lasting recovery.
Specialized programs support individuals with dementia and Alzheimer’s, providing focused care for cognitive challenges. Children with behavioral issues like ADHD receive targeted therapies and family involvement to help them thrive. This wide range of services ensures quality care for patients of all ages across the community.
